    Blizzard doesn't need to gauge shit reaction wise from the community. The people working on this project already live, eat, and breath this kind of stuff. Everything you know and see with these races was made by them already. They don't need you complaining or praising about a character's lips to decide what they are going to do.

    People seem to ignore context and just shove whatever they need to reason wise into place when something like the Worgen female happens, as if suddenly all character models are precarious for the team to work on.

    Blizzard is taking a long time on this because it's a labor of love and there is no fucking rush. A new race in this games takes a year or more to develop with the way the artists work, and this project has barely been worked on for a year now off and on as it is. You may think "oh, but Blizzard already knows what an orc looks like so it shouldn't take as long", but they knew what every new race in this game looked like anyways beforehand. The trick is in creating a new way to look at the race while making it familiar and cool looking.

    This isn't a matter of just drawing a cool orc and saying "model this, rig it, and get the animators cracking". They draw and conceptualize multiple versions of things. Look at how many hairstyles and noses and facial options you see in the game now, they are creating multiple versions of each of them to see what works and what doesn't here and there.

    There is no conspiracy to keep people subscribed by stringing them along with this project. There is no danger of Blizzard deciding this project is too hard at this point, it's just going to take a little while as it's being done on the side along with 2 content patches being worked on at the same time and a brand new expansion which people seem to forget.

    This isn't just a WOTLK era model edit like the new troll female everyone is excited about. They are reanimating every single animation we have to look more modern and stylized. They are giving each race fully animated facial expressions. If you think the troll female looks cool, you haven't seen anything yet.

    As it's going to be an optional choice for the people who want to keep using their original character model, Blizzard isn't going to recreate double the brand new armor and textures for every new armor set they release in the game, so don't think this is taking so long because they are redoing the armor for the old models. That would double their work load from here on out. They will of course have the same basic shape in their skeletons so the attachment points on the armor line up exactly the same so the old dwarf and the new dwarf can wear the same thing. The only thing I imagine that's an issue there is perhaps new clipping issues due to a dreadlock or pony tail not being in exactly the same place.
